Wie kann ich unterschiedliche Einstellungswerte für Subdomains verwenden?

Hallo zusammen! Frohe Weihnachten!
Ich habe ein Forum, das auf Discourse basiert, und es hat mehrere Subdomains wie diese:
Hauptforum: example.com
Subdomain: A.example.com, B.example.com, …
Alle verwenden dieselben Benutzer, dieselben Themen und dieselben Beiträge.
Ich werde jedoch unterschiedliche Theme-Einstellungswerte für jede Domain festlegen.
Daher werde ich die Tabelle site_setting ändern, um Domain-Informationen mit den Einstellungswerten zu speichern, und auch das Forum ändern, um die Domain zu überprüfen und unterschiedliche Einstellungswerte aus der Datenbank abzurufen.
Ist das möglich? Wie kann ich das implementieren?
Kann ich eine Instanz für die Hauptdomain und die Subdomains mit einer einzigen Datenbank verwenden?
Bitte helfen Sie mir, diese Probleme zu lösen.
Vielen Dank.

1 „Gefällt mir“

Ich weiß es nicht, aber ich bin wirklich neugierig: Warum sollte man denselben Inhalt auf mehreren verschiedenen Domains anbieten?

2 „Gefällt mir“

Nein. Das geht nicht. Dieselben Daten auf mehreren Domains bereitzustellen, ist ein großes SEO-No-Go.

Sie könnten mehrere Discourse-Server haben, vielleicht mit Multisite-Konfiguration mit Docker. Sie könnten unterschiedliche Inhalte haben, aber eine Authentifizierung einer Website teilen.

2 „Gefällt mir“